There's no requirement to have a PSHE policy, but you may want to have one in place.
Our model:
- Takes account of relevant guidance and good practice
- Refers to the requirements for relationships and sex education (RSE) and health education for primary and secondary schools
- Is approved by Forbes Solicitors
You should use it alongside your RSE policy, which you're required to have – download and adapt our model RSE policy.
